If I can get enough interest, I may consider doing like a "group buy" on this first contact cleaner I have. You spread it onto GLASS ONLY as a liquid, then once it's dry, just peel it off. Works extremely well :)

Glass only because the chemicals melt plastic lenses. I found out the hard way.
